The Role of Battery Welding in EV Manufacturing

In electric vehicle production, welding is not just a structural function—it is an electrical necessity. Battery welding machines connect cells and modules, creating energy pathways within the battery. These welds must be thermally stable, corrosion-resistant, and electrically conductive to withstand long-term charging and discharging cycles. Poor weld quality can lead to voltage drops, thermal runaways, and even fire risks, making laser-based precision welding essential for EV safety and performance. 

Evolution of Battery Welding Machines

Initially, battery pack assembly relied on ultrasonic or resistance welding. However, the demand for miniaturisation and higher energy densities has led to the rise of battery tab welders and laser-based welding methods. These machines use focused beams to join metal tabs to cells with minimal heat diffusion. Unlike traditional methods, laser welding ensures high repeatability, better surface finish, and faster processing times. With programmable parameters, modern machines also support automated production lines. 

Advantages of Battery Tab Welders in Power Assembly

Battery tab welders offer multiple benefits in EV power module assembly. They ensure strong bonds between cells and busbars, even when working with dissimilar metals like aluminium and copper. Laser tab welding produces narrow heat-affected zones, reducing material distortion and extending battery life. Their ability to operate in high-speed environments without compromising quality makes them a preferred choice for manufacturers scaling up EV battery production. 

How Lithium Battery Spot Welding Machines Improve Safety

Lithium battery spot welding machines are designed to handle the delicate nature of lithium-ion cells, which are sensitive to heat and vibration. These machines deliver concentrated energy bursts in milliseconds, ensuring secure joins without overheating. This is crucial for maintaining internal cell chemistry and preventing defects like shorts or leaks. Spot welding also allows for denser cell configurations, supporting the development of compact, high-capacity battery designs.

The 18650 Spot Welder: Standard for Modern Battery Packs

The 18650 spot welder has become a cornerstone in EV battery manufacturing. With EVs commonly using cylindrical 18650 cells, precise welding is vital for cell-to-cell and cell-to-busbar connections. These welders provide dual-pulse or triple-pulse welding modes to ensure strong, clean joins. Temperature control, weld monitoring, and pulse shaping make 18650 spot welders reliable, especially in automated battery pack lines where uniformity is critical.
